Hard Knocks is returning to HBO this year, with the Chicago Bears announced as one of the featured teams. The NFL had three teams in contention for the show: the Bears, Broncos, and Saints. The Bears were ultimately chosen due to their lack of a first-year head coach, recent playoff appearances, and absence from Hard Knocks in over a decade.
The excitement surrounding quarterback Caleb Williams, who was the first overall draft pick in 2024, likely played a role in the Bears being selected for the show. Both the Bears and the NFL are eager for Williams to become a standout player in the league, and Hard Knocks will give fans an early glimpse into his career.
